Patent number: 12556061Abstract: An induction motor cooling system is disclosed. The induction motor cooling system comprises a plurality of interconnected cooling channels and a plurality of air ducts characterized between inner circumference and outer circumference of the stator frame. The plurality of interconnected cooling channels is designed in a pre-designed meandering fashion to envelop the stator frame. And similarly, each of the plurality of air ducts of pre-defined dimension is axially positioned in equidistance spread to envelop the stator frame. Cooling channels enable flow of coolant liquid to dissipate heat produced by the stator coils. Air ducts helps in cooling the stator coil temperature and the rotor temperature by inflow and outflow of air. Air entry and exit to the plurality of air ducts is enabled by a set of inflow air openings and a set of outflow air openings fabricated on the inner circumference of the stator frame.Type: GrantFiled: December 24, 2021Date of Patent: February 17, 2026Assignee: ENTUPLE E-MOBILITY PRIVATE LIMITEDInventors: Tijo Thomas, Deshmukh Laxman Vitthalrao

Patent number: 12483086Abstract: An induction motor is disclosed. The induction motor comprises a motor casing, fabricated in an irregular octagonal shape with a central open area. The motor casing is configured to house a cooling system within an outer wall and an inner wall of the motor casing. The cooling system comprises a plurality of interconnected cooling channels and a plurality of air ducts. The induction motor comprises a stator assembly housed within the central open area of the motor casing, a rotor assembly fitted inside the stator assembly and a shaft configured to be fitted to the rotor assembly. The induction motor also comprises a fan positioned on the first axial end of the induction motor. The fan is configured to assist inflow of air into the plurality of air ducts.Type: GrantFiled: December 24, 2021Date of Patent: November 25, 2025Assignee: Entuple E-Mobility Pvt LtdInventors: Tijo Thomas, Vitthal Shreepad Deexit, Deshmukh Laxman Vitthalrao

Patent number: 12438408Abstract: An induction motor is disclosed. The induction motor comprises a stator body assembly. The stator body assembly is characterized by a hollow cylindrical stator stack and a set of intertwined stator rods. The hollow cylindrical stator stack is fabricated with a plurality of rectangular shaped open slots on inner surface periphery and a plurality of cleating notches on outer surface periphery. The induction motor also comprises a rotor body assembly. The rotor body assembly is housed within the stator body assembly and configured to mount over multi-step shaft of the induction motor. The rotor body assembly is characterized by a hollow cylindrical rotor stack fabricated with a plurality of predesigned rotor slots on outer surface periphery, a plurality of vent holes and a notch on inner surface periphery. The rotor body assembly is also characterized by a set of rotor bars, housed within the plurality of predesigned rotor slots.Type: GrantFiled: December 24, 2021Date of Patent: October 7, 2025Assignee: Entuple E-Mobility Pvt. Ltd.Inventors: Tijo Thomas, Vitthal Shreepad Deexit

Patent number: 10725004Abstract: Embodiments relate generally to systems and methods for determining the location of a gas detector device, wherein the location may be within a predefined location zone, and automatically configuring the gas detector device based on the location zone. Each location zone in a facility may be associated with a configuration for the gas detector device. The location of the gas detector device may be monitored by a central station, and when it is determined that a gas detector device has moved from one location zone to another, the configuration of the gas detector device may be updated accordingly. Additionally, other parameters may be monitored by the central station and/or the gas detector device to determine the appropriate configuration of the gas detector device.Type: GrantFiled: September 28, 2018Date of Patent: July 28, 2020Assignee: Honeywell International Inc.Inventors: Vidyasagar Baba Maddila, Tijo Thomas, Kurian George, Arunkumar Kamalakannan, Suryaramya Talluri, Swapna Illuru

Publication number: 20180357444Abstract: The present invention discloses a system, method, and device for unified access control on federated database. In one implementation, a federated system to provide a unified access control for the data stored in federated databases is disclosed. The federated system comprise at least one central access controller configured to receive at least a query plan generated; verify the query plan generated against at least a user rights pre-stored in at least one central authorization metadata table, a table and an associated column name from the query plan is verified; update, if the user rights pre-stored allow access to the query plan verified, the query plan generated; convert the query plan updated to at least a physical query for execution by at least one database; and execute the physical query to return at least a result for the federated query received.Type: ApplicationFiled: August 20, 2018Publication date: December 13, 2018Applicant: HUAWEI TECHNOLOGIES CO.,LTD.Inventors: V Vimal Das Kammath, Tijo Thomas, Vinod Krishnankutty Chandrika

Patent number: 9563992Abstract: A system and method of associating, assigning, and authenticating users with and to a personal protective equipment device is provided. A method can include receiving biometric data, processing the received biometric data, and based on the processing, associating a user with a personal protective equipment device.Type: GrantFiled: December 1, 2014Date of Patent: February 7, 2017Assignee: Honeywell International Inc.Inventors: Tijo Thomas, Kurian George, Baba Vidyasagar Maddila, Arunkumar Kamalakannan, Cyril Arokiaraj Arool Emmanuel, Shashikant Gulaguli, Nukala Sateesh Kumar
